How they compare
Saudi Arabia currently reports 25,445 constant 2015 US$ per person against 1,872 constant 2015 US$ per person in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income), a difference of 23,573 constant 2015 US$ per person.
That makes Saudi Arabia's figure about 13.6 times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income)'s.
Across all 24 years both countries report, Saudi Arabia has been ahead every year.
Saudi Arabia ranks 33rd and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income) ranks 35th of 163 countries.
Saudi Arabia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Saudi Arabia |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income) |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 16,236 constant 2015 US$ per person | 1,447 constant 2015 US$ per person | 14,789 constant 2015 US$ per person | Saudi Arabia |
| 2010s | 22,971 constant 2015 US$ per person | 1,724 constant 2015 US$ per person | 21,247 constant 2015 US$ per person | Saudi Arabia |
| 2020s | 24,962 constant 2015 US$ per person | 1,794 constant 2015 US$ per person | 23,168 constant 2015 US$ per person | Saudi Arabia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
